NATS AUDIO LINKNJEL0497S01DescriptionNJEL0497S0101The link with the NATS IMMU implies that the audio unit can basically only be operated if connected to the
matching NATS IMMU to which the audio unit was initially fitted on the production line.
Since radio operation is impossible after the link with the NATS is disrupted theft of the audio unit is basically
useless since special equipment is required to reset the audio unit.
Initialization process for audio units that are linked to the NATS IMMU
New audio units will be delivered to the factories in the ªNEWº state, i.e. ready to be linked with the vehicle's
NATS. When the audio unit in ªNEWº state is first switched on at the factory, it will start up communication
with the vehicle's immobiliser control unit (IMMU) and send a code (the ªaudio unit Codeº) to the IMMU. The
IMMU will then store this code, which is unique to each audio unit, in its (permanent) memory.
Upon receipt of the code by the IMMU, the NATS will confirm correct receipt of the audio unit code to the audio
unit. Hereafter, the audio unit will operate as normal.
During the initialisation process, ªNEWº is displayed on the audio unit display. Normally though, communica-
tion between audio unit and IMMU takes such a short time (300 ms) that the audio unit seems to switch on
directly without showing ªNEWº on its display.
Normal operation
Each time the audio unit is switched on afterwards, the audio unit code will be verified between the audio unit
and the NATS before the audio unit becomes operational. During the code verification process, ªWAITº is
shown on the audio unit display. Again, the communication takes such a short time (300 ms) that the audio
unit seems to switch on directly without showing ªWAITº on its display.
When the radio is locked
In case of a audio unit being linked with the vehicle's NATS (immobilizer system), disconnection of the link
between the audio unit and the IMMU will cause the audio unit to switch into the lock (ªSECUREº) mode in
which the audio unit is fully inoperative. Hence, repair of the audio unit is basically impossible, unless the audio
unit is reset to the ªNEWº state for which special decoding equipment is required.

System DescriptionNJEL0480FUNCTIONNJEL0480S01Multi-remote control system has the following function.
+Door lock (and set super lock)
+Door unlock (and release super lock)
+Hazard reminder
LOCK OPERATIONNJEL0480S02To lock door by multi-remote controller, the key switch must be at OFF.
When the LOCK signal is input to time control unit (the antenna of the system is combined with time control
unit)
Then time control unit controls to lock doors and set super lock (models with super lock).
UNLOCK OPERATIONNJEL0480S03When the UNLOCK signal is input to time control unit (the antenna of the system is combined with time con-
trol unit)
Time control unit controls to unlock driver's door and release super lock (models with super lock).
Then, if an unlock signal is sent from the remote controller again within 5 seconds, all other doors will be
unlocked.
HAZARD REMINDERNJEL0480S04When the doors are locked or unlocked by multi-remote controller, supply power to turn lamps hazard reminder
flashes as follows
+Lock operation: Flash once
+Unlock operation: Flash twice

Anti-theft System=NJEL0523DESCRIPTIONNJEL0523S03The 4-digit PIN must be entered when the display shows ªenter your PINº at the time the vehicle is purchased.
RHD ModelsNJEL0523S0301By integrating the Navigation System in the vehicle's interior and linking it to the vehicle's immobilizer system,
the possibility of the Navigation unit being stolen is effectively reduced. Each time the Navigation System is
switched on, the Navigation System will start up communication with the vehicle's immobilizer control unit
(IMMU) and verify an identification code. If communication cannot be established, or the verified code is
incorrect, the Navigation System will lock up showing ªANTI-THEFT FUNCTIONº on the Navigation display.
